SY8368A High Efficiency Fast Response 8A Continuous, 16A Peak, 28V Input Synchronous Step Down Regulator General Description Features The SY8368A develops a high efficiency synchronous step-down DC/DC regulator capable of delivering 8A continuous, 16A peak current. The SY8368A operates over a wide input voltage range from 4.0V to 28V and integrates main switch and synchronous switch with very low RDS(ON) to minimize the conduction loss.       The SY8368A adopts the instant PWM architecture to achieve fast transient responses for high step down applications and high efficiency at light loads. Pin Description Ground pin Inductor pin. Connect this pin to the switching node of inductor Input pin. Decouple this pin to the GND pin with at least a 10μF ceramic capacitor. Boot-strap pin. Supply high side gate driver. Decouple this pin to the LX pin with a 0.1μF ceramic capacitor. Internal 3.3V LDO output. Power supply for internal analog circuits and driving circuit. Bypass a capacitor to GND. Output feedback pin. Connect this pin to the center point of the output resistor divider (as shown in Figure 1) to program the output voltage: VOUT=0.6×(1+R1/R2) Current limit setting pin. The current limit is set to 8A, 12A or 16A when this pin is pulled low, floating or pulled high respectively. Power good Indicator. Open drain output when the output voltage is within 90% to 120% of regulation point. Enable control. Pull this pin high to turn on the IC. Do not leave this pin floating. Silergy Corp.
